Latest Patents: Chu's sole patent is titled "Method and Apparatus for Operating Displayed Area of Electronic Map and Recording Medium." This invention presents a method and apparatus designed to enhance the interaction with electronic maps. The process begins with the display of a specific area on an electronic map. Notably, it incorporates an indicating object for points of interest (POIs) located outside the visible area. When users select this indicating object, they can transition their displayed area to include the desired POI, enabling efficient navigation and access to relevant information with minimal effort. This innovative method significantly improves the user interface for electronic maps, streamlining the user's ability to find information quickly.
